Understanding Forex Trading
The foreign exchange market, or forex, is the largest financial market in the world, where currencies are traded. The market exists as a global decentralized market for trading national currencies against one another. It operates 24 hours a day, five days a week, and involves a diverse range of participants, including banks, financial institutions, corporations, governments, and individual retail traders.

Key Strategies for Live Forex Trading
To navigate the complexities of live forex trading successfully, it is vital to employ effective strategies. Here are some proven strategies that traders can use:
1. Scalping
Scalping is a strategy that involves making numerous small trades throughout the day to capitalize on minor price fluctuations. Traders often hold positions for only a few seconds to minutes, aiming for quick profits. This strategy requires a strong understanding of market movements and quick decision-making skills.

2. Day Trading
Day trading involves opening and closing trades within the same trading day. Unlike scalping, day traders might hold positions for several hours, seeking to profit from fluctuations throughout the day. Successful day trading relies on technical analysis, market trends, and timely entry and exit points.
3. Swing Trading
Swing trading is a medium-term strategy where traders aim to capture gains over several days to weeks. Swing traders often rely on technical analysis to identify potential reversal points and trends. This strategy can be less stressful than day trading, as it does not require constant monitoring of the market.
4. Position Trading
Position trading is a long-term strategy focused on the overall trend of the market. Position traders hold trades for weeks, months, or even years, making decisions based on fundamental analysis rather than short-term price movements. This approach requires patience and a deep understanding of economic factors influencing currency prices.
Tools and Resources for Live Forex Trading
To enhance your live forex trading experience, it’s crucial to use the right tools and resources. Here are some essential tools that traders should consider:
1. Trading Platforms

A reliable trading platform is the cornerstone of successful forex trading. Popular platforms such as MetaTrader 4 (MT4), MetaTrader 5 (MT5), and cTrader offer robust features, including charting tools, automated trading systems, and access to various markets.
2. Economic Calendars
Economic calendars are vital for staying updated on significant economic events that impact currency prices. By monitoring announcements such as interest rate decisions, GDP reports, and employment figures, traders can prepare for market volatility.
3. Technical Analysis Tools
Technical analysis tools, including indicators like Moving Averages, Relative Strength Index (RSI), and Fibonacci retracement levels, can provide insights into price movements and help traders make informed decisions.
4. News Feeds
Access to real-time news feeds is essential for forex traders. Market-moving news can dramatically impact currency prices, and being informed allows traders to react rapidly.
